NITA Unveils Online Skills Upgrading Training Approval System to Enhance Efficiency and Transparency
 
Employers will soon say goodbye to the cumbersome manual process of seeking training approval from the National Industrial Training Authority (NITA), following the development and piloting of a new Online Skills Upgrading Training Approval System.
Announcing the innovation, Director Industrial Training and Skills Development, Jane Kamau, revealed that the platform will officially go live on 1st November 2025, marking a major milestone in NITA’s digital transformation journey. The system will allow employers to submit and track training approval applications online — ensuring faster turnaround times, enhanced transparency and convenience from anywhere, at any time.
A pilot phase involving 25 employers, among them Thika Coffee Mills, Farm Input Promotions Africa, Kenchic PLC, and Kenya Tea Packers, confirmed the platform’s functionality and ease of use. Employers praised its efficiency and transparency, terming it a significant leap in service delivery.
Director Kamau made the announcement in Naivasha on Tuesday, where she represented NITA’s Acting Director General during a high-level stakeholders’ forum convened by the Agricultural Employers’ Association (AEA) and the Kenya Tea Growers Association (KTGA).
The meeting discussed the rollout of the Flower Grower III and Mechanical Tea Harvester III curricula, aimed at boosting productivity, competitiveness and employee empowerment through skills development, assessment and certification.
Speaking during the forum, AEA Chief Executive Officer, Wesley Siele, and Kenya Tea Growers Association CEO, Linda Oluoch, lauded the curricula as critical tools for aligning workforce skills with the evolving demands of the agricultural sector.
AEA Chairman, Kirimi Mpungu, commended the strong collaboration with NITA in implementing levy training and reimbursement programmes, which he said have enabled employers to continually upskill their workforce and enhance performance across the sector.
